Key Components of a Gaming PC
When it comes to building or choosing a gaming PC, several components are critical for optimal performance. These include:
– Processor (CPU): The brain of the computer, responsible for executing instructions and handling tasks.
– Graphics Card (GPU): Crucial for gaming performance, as it renders images on the screen and handles graphics processing.
– RAM (Memory): Determines how many applications can run simultaneously without significant performance drops.
– Storage: Affects loading times and overall system responsiveness, with SSDs (Solid State Drives) offering faster performance compared to traditional HDDs (Hard Disk Drives).
